Analyzing the Lithium Connection
When discussing ozempic and lithium, the primary concern often cited in scientific literature GLP-1s for Lithium-Induced Damage in Bipolar Disorder Treatment relates to how changes in gastric motility might impact systemic levels. Lithium is a mood stabilizer that requires precise dosing to maintain an effective range in the blood. If the transit time of the gastrointestinal tract is extended, it can create variability in how absorption occurs, potentially impacting the serum levels of lithium.
